Esselmont, Brigit: - Brigit Esselmont is known worldwide as a professional Tarot reader & teacher, Amazon bestselling author of The Ultimate Guide to Tarot Card Meanings, intuitive business coach and spiritual entrepreneur. She is the Founder of Biddy Tarot (www.biddytarot.com) and inspires over four million people each year to live more mindful and enlightened lives, using the Tarot as a guide. A self-confessed Tarot lover, Brigit can't help but spread the love to other Tarot enthusiasts. She is the author of two popular Tarot guides and has taught over 1200 students to read Tarot with confidence. Brigit is also a successful intuitive entrepreneur and business coach, helping heart-centered professionals build their own business empires that are aligned with their soul purpose. Brigit believes anyone can read Tarot. She doesn't own a crystal ball nor a crushed velvet dress. She's simply a down-to-earth, practical Taurus who likes to use the Tarot cards in every day life. When she's not reading Tarot, Brigit loves spending time with her two daughters and husband on the Sunshine Coast, Australia.
